Excellent presentation
The Editor, Sir:

I believe the prime minister's Budget speech was excellent from start to finish. I would grade it 9.5 out of 10. I was shocked by the rating given to it by Ralston Hyman, Martin Henry and Dennis Chung in their reviews. They each gave it 7 out of 10. I was even more shocked by Chung as I have often considered him an objective thinker.

I am sure the prime minister will never be able to satisfy the aspiration of all the people of this country but certainly there are those who are seeing the light of a new day. It was most gratifying to see the abject failure of those who attempted to protest against the new tax measures.

There are those who, wittingly or unwittingly, try to discredit his leadership style by comparing him with Barack Obama as if to suggest that he is merely imitating him.

But they need to be reminded that Prime Minister Golding has been acting on his own initiative long before Barack Obama became president of the United States of America. Our prime minister had promised an enlightened style of leadership and an inclusive form of Government, as well as better governance. He ought to be credited for the steps he has taken to fulfil those promises and for the quality of leadership shown.

As a nation, we need to support him with our prayers and goodwill. May he continue his good work, the God of heaven being with him.
